With a little digging, you'll find that the oldest still-standing building in Montana date back to the 1860s. The very oldest recognized building is the Fort Connah Site from 1846. Our list isn't about the very oldest mansions in the state, but some of the most significant and beautiful to this day.

Their architecture and recognizability make these stunning buildings some of the most famous in all of Montana. History was made within the walls of these mansions, and most are available for the public to view and tour.

Montana became a state on November 8th, 1889 and ever since with railroads, ranching, and mining - Montana's wealth began to grow, as did it's homes. Some are in public hands (such as the Story Mansion in Bozeman), and others are museums...or are still being used as private homes. What technically defines a "mansion"? According to Smith & Associates Real Estate, a mansion is described as this:

The typical real estate definition of a mansion is a home that offers at least 5,000 square feet of space and at least five to six bedrooms. Mansions typically sit on small acreage (homes set on vast amounts of land are considered estates).

Montana has more than 1,100 listings on the National Register of Historic Places. Not all of those listings are buildings or mansions, of course. But it does give some context to how many places in the state are historically significant. Some of those stories involve our big, beautiful, old mansions.
